Horticulture ~ Plants and Grounds
Caring for the Garden

To keep the garden growing and healthy requires basic gardening such as weeding, raking, planting, mulching, pruning, renovating planting beds, adding new plants, amending soil and monitoring the health of the collections. Using an Integrated Pest Management approach, we practice maintenance techniques that promote plant health, have minimal negative effects on the environment and benefit wildlife habitat.

 

Volunteers are key to the success of the Horticulture program
